gcc 4.8 identifies several places where code of the form memset(x, 0,
sizeof(x)); is used incorrectly, meaning that less memory is set to
zero than required.

kdd runs in dom0, attaches to a domain and speaks the Windows kd serial
protocol over a TCP connection (which should go to kd or windbg, e.g.
by having another VM with its virtual COM1 set up as a TCP listener).
It doesn't do breakpoints &c yet, and windbg can get quite confused
since the kernel debugger's not actually running, but it's good enough
to extract backtraces from wedged VMs.
